摘要:
查询树上某个节点的子节点的标号小于其标号的数目. 一个trick是建立线段树之后,从标号小的向标号大的来做更新. 1: #include 2: #include 3: #include 4: #include 5: #include 6: #include 7: using namespace std; 8: #pragma comme... 阅读全文
摘要:
单点修改树中某个节点,查询子树的性质.DFS序 子树序列一定在父节点的DFS序列之内,所以可以用线段树维护. 1: /* 2: DFS序 +线段树 3: */ 4: 5: #include 6: #include 7: #include 8: #include 9: #include 10: #include 11: ... 阅读全文